  • What is a Triathlon?

    A triathlon is a challenging endurance event that combines swimming, cycling, and running into a single continuous race.

    In a typical triathlon, athletes start with a swim segment, usually in open water like a lake or ocean. This is followed by a transition to the cycling portion, where participants jump on their bikes and cover a specified distance. The race concludes with the running segment, where competitors showcase their endurance with a run. The transitions between each discipline are also crucial as athletes switch gears from swimming gear to cycling attire and then to running shoes, impacting their overall race time. Triathlons come in various distances, such as sprint, Olympic, half Ironman, and Ironman, catering to different levels of athletes’ abilities and endurance.
